Hi everyone! Today, I’m going to review four BB creams from Dr. Jart+. I’ve been using these BB creams for the past month, and it’s my first time trying products from this company.

Fotor0105175920

Here is a quick review that encompasses all of the BB creams in this sampler set:

~ Pros ~

  • Packaging: I like how they all have the same tube packaging, and the different colors make it easy to find the BB cream I’m looking for. The label is easy to read.
  • I like the consistency of all these BB creams! They’re not too thick but they’re not watery either. It’s a light cream that is easy to blend.
  • Decent light coverage.
  • Non-irritating. None of these BB creams caused a negative reaction in my skin.

~ Cons ~

  • None that encompass all of the BB creams, but there are some things I dislike for specific ones.

Dr. Jart+ Dis-a-Pore

Description from Dr. Jart+’s US website:

“What it is:
An innovative formula to moisturize, protect, and correct pores for a beautiful, radiant complexion.

What it is formulated to do:
– For combination to oily skin, this powerful formula conceals and treats enlarged pores and blemishes
– Features SPF 30 sun protection
– Comes in one universal shade

This all-in-one, innovative pore tightening formula delivers flawless coverage, sun protection, and hydration benefits. The perfect mixture of smoothing powder and elastic silky polymer gives tight adherence and covers blemishes and pores, fine lines, and uneven skintone. It helps to smooth and clear skin by treating large pores while herbal extracts control excessive sebum and present a fresh look all day long. The multifunctional BB cream brightens, provides antiwrinkle benefits, and protects the skin from harm UV rays, leaving the complexion smooth, beautiful, and natural-looking.”

Pros

  • Easy to blend
  • Evens skin tone (both color and texture)

Cons

  • Can’t think of any outright cons, but it doesn’t feel like a perfect fit for my skin. I think the color is off, but I still love this product!

Dr. Jart+ Black Label Detox

Description from Dr. Jart+’s US website:

“What it is:
A purifying face cream that provides age defense, and hides uneven skintone and blemishes.

What it is formulated to do:
– Botanical Formula to purify and calm blemish prone or sensitive skin while also combating dark spots and pollutants for an enhanced radiance
– Features SPF 25 sun protection
– Comes in one universal shade

Perfect and protect skin instantly with this all-in-one multifunctional Beauty Balm. This triple-action formula naturally covers blemishes and uneven skintone, and contains botanical actives to purify and calm blemish-prone or irritated skin. Arbutin works to erase unwanted dark spots, while caviar extract and antioxidants protect skin from inner and outer pollutants for an enhanced radiance. Lightweight with sunscreen protection for simple, one-step neutralizing coverage, this soothing cream delivers optimal results for both women and men.”

Pros

  • Matches my skin tone
  • Easy to blend
  • Evens out my skin tone (my acne is less noticeable since the BB cream covers up the redness, but the bumps are still visible)

Cons

  • My skin is slightly sticky to the touch after application.

Other information

  • This BB cream has a slightly dewy finish, but it’s not shiny. I usually prefer matte, but I’m okay with this level of dewiness.

Dr. Jart+ Premium

Description from Dr. Jart+’s US website:

“What it is:
A one-step balm that perfects the appearance of skin while protecting it from the sun and environmental factors.

What it is formulated to do:
– Bio-Peptide Complex infused with white gold to provide antiaging properties and promote natural collagen
– Features SPF 45 sun protection
– Comes in one universal shade

A moisturizer, sunscreen, and treatment serum, this all-in-one product also includes advanced brightening properties. Ideal under makeup, its natural looking coverage minimizes the appearance of imperfections and evens the skintone. Antioxidant bio-peptides and adenosine protect skin from harsh environmental factors while restoring firmness and elasticity. This lightweight formula features mineral sunscreens to provide broad spectrum sun protection from both UVA and UVB rays. Skin is left looking smooth, perfect, and natural.”

Pros

  • Easy to blend
  • Highest SPF

Cons

  • Has an unpleasant smell (it reminds me of stale chips…)
  • Doesn’t cover up my red spots (from irritated acne)

Dr. Jart+ Radiance

Description from Dr. Jart+’s US website:

“What it is:
A one-step balm that perfects the appearance of skin while protecting it from the sun and environmental factors.

What it is formulated to do:
– Next generation, multifunctional formula for radiance, brightening, hydrating, and firming benefits
– Features SPF 30 sun protection
– Comes in one universal shade

This innovative BB cream enhances your natural beauty in one simple step. Radiance capsules help even skintone and highlight skin’s natural radiance while the moisture-rich formula provides buildable, natural-looking coverage. Snow lotus and vitamin tree fruit brighten the complexion, transforming dull skin into a head-turning luster glow. It moisturizes and protects skin from harmful sun damage and conceals and treats uneven skintone. Skin looks smooth, flawless, and healthy.”

Pros

  • Relatively easy to blend (more difficult than the other ones for me)
  • Absorbs into skin quickly
  • Hides redness
  • Buildable coverage

Cons

  • Accentuates dry spots on my skin unless I apply multiple layers
  • Slightly dewy finish that looks shiny even in natural light (more dewy than the Black Label Detox one)

Conclusion

Overall, I like all of these BB creams. My favorite is the Dis-a-Pore one, and my least favorite one is the Premium one. I will definitely finish using all of these products because I never want to waste anything. Would I repurchase this? I won’t be repurchasing this sampler set since I’ve already given each BB cream in this set a try. I might purchase a full size tube of the Dis-a-Pore BB cream someday, but I don’t think I will for a long time. I still want to find the perfect BB cream for my skin, so the next BB cream I purchase will be a different one to try. Even though I do like the Dis-a-Pore BB cream a lot, it’s still not a perfect fit for my skin.

I wore these lenses for a photoshoot with Studio du Petit Oiseau. They were comfortable to wear all day, regardless of location (in a car, up the mountain, in the grass…).

_DSC1321w

Photographer: Studio du Petit Oiseau

Even from a distance, the gray color shows up on my eyes! My favorite part of these lenses is their comfort. I wore them for a recent K-Pop dance performance, and they did not irritate my eyes even when I was dancing and sweating.

12184192_10207345749069370_8329284055300182960_o

I don’t wear these lenses for cosplay, but if you cosplay someone with gray-colored eyes, this would be a great fit for you! I wear these lenses for fashion and fun, and they have never caused any issues. Remember: If you use circle lenses, be sure to take proper care of them.

Packaging: ☆☆☆☆☆ I’ve never had an issue with UNIQSO’s packaging before! Feel free to look at some of my previous UNIQSO reviews to see how they package their circle lenses. They have consistent packaging, and this time, it was no different.

Style: ☆☆☆☆☆ I love the design of these lenses! These lenses have amazing enlargement… The black limbal ring really helps define your eyes. The opening in the center of the lenses is large, so your vision won’t be obscured.

Color: ☆☆☆☆☆ The gray is just as I wanted it to be! It’s a deep gray that would be flattering for anyone.

Comfort: ☆☆☆☆☆ These are so comfy! I think these are my comfiest lenses of this diameter yet! Sometimes I forget I’m wearing lenses because I can hardly feel them.

Here is the description for this BB Cushion from Target’s website:

“The revolutionary 5-in-1 BB in a convenient compact. Go beyond your regular BB cream. Broad-spectrum SPF 50 blocks harmful UVA/UVB rays, while skin perfecting Optimal Mineral Water cools and hydrates upon application. Prevent shine and brighten skin by visibly reducing dark spots. Patented air cushion distributes just the right amount of BB cream. Apply whenever and wherever you want, with no buildup or bother. All day flawless skin is just 1 step away with BB Cushion.”

The BB Cushion comes with a refill, which is great! I’m not sure how long this will last, but I’ve been using the product for a week now and you do not need to use much to cover your face.

DSC_0163 copy.jpg

The design is so sleek and sophisticated! I love this packaging. This is the second BB Cushion I’ve tried; the first one I tried was the Ossion Secret Total Cushion, but I wasn’t satisfied with that one since it was way too light for my skin tone. The packaging of the Laneige one also looks nicer than the Ossion one (which is ironic since the Ossion one was ridiculously expensive).

DSC_0165.jpg

The Laneige cushion comes with this lovely dark blue applicator sponge! It sits on a tray that separates it from the product. There’s also a handy-dandy mirror! This mirror is so nice… It’s way better than my current compact mirror.

DSC_0166.jpg

Ah yes, that feeling when you remove the film from the product… There’s no turning back!

DSC_0169.jpg

The air cushion has tiny little holes to enable product distribution. I haven’t had any issues with getting excess product; when I press down with the applicator sponge, only a little bit of product comes out at a time. This is ideal since if I need more product, it’s easy to press again and continue.

CSC_0194.jpg

I tried the product on my arm first, and was disappointed by the shininess.  Do you see that shimmery spot on my skin? That’s the BB cream. I hoped it would be less shiny on my face, and it wasn’t too bad. This BB cream would be fine for daily wear since it gives a light coverage. It doesn’t cover up much, but evens out the skin tone. Sadly, my pores still look huge with this product. I was also hoping this BB cream would be matte, but it’s not. There was no mention of shimmer or shine in the product description, but oh well! I’ll still use this product up.

Here’s a close-up photo of me wearing no makeup except for the Laneige BB Cushion:

DSC_0186.jpg

As you can see, the product doesn’t do anything for my giant pores. It does even my skin tone though, so my acne scars (and that chicken pox scar from forever ago) blend into the rest of my skin. The color of this BB cream is lighter than my skin tone, but it’s not as light as the Ossion one.

I don’t think I will repurchase this, since I would rather find a matte BB cushion. I will try to use this daily and see if it offers any skincare benefits.  If so, I’ll write about it!
